Question: Should governments invest more in renewable energy infrastructure?


Model Answer:
In recent years, the world has witnessed a significant rise in environmental concerns due to climate change and its negative impact on ecosystems. Governments across the globe are now faced with the challenge of deciding whether to prioritize investment in renewable energy infrastructure or continue relying on non-renewable resources. This essay will discuss the importance of investing in renewable energy, highlighting the potential benefits to both the environment and the economy, as well as examining alternative perspectives that may question the necessity of such a shift.

Investing in renewable energy infrastructure has several benefits for the environment. Renewable sources of energy, such as solar, wind, and hydroelectric power, produce significantly less greenhouse gas emissions compared to traditional fossil fuels. As a result, this reduces air pollution and mitigates the effects of climate change. Furthermore, renewable energy sources are more sustainable in the long term, as they rely on naturally replenished resources rather than finite reserves like coal, oil, and natural gas.

Economically, investing in renewable energy infrastructure can create a plethora of job opportunities across various sectors, from manufacturing to installation and maintenance. This not only helps reduce unemployment rates but also stimulates economic growth by attracting new investments and fostering innovation. Additionally, as the cost of producing energy from renewable sources continues to decrease, it becomes increasingly competitive with traditional energy sources, which in turn reduces reliance on imported fossil fuels and strengthens national energy security.

However, some argue that governments should not prioritize investment in renewable energy infrastructure due to its high initial cost. The establishment of new renewable energy plants often requires significant capital investments upfront, while the return on investment may only be realized over an extended period. Moreover, critics contend that governments should focus on improving energy efficiency and implementing conservation measures, which can yield more immediate benefits in terms of reducing energy consumption and associated costs.

In conclusion, although there are valid concerns regarding the initial cost of investing in renewable energy infrastructure, the long-term environmental and economic benefits far outweigh these drawbacks. Governments must recognize that transitioning to renewable energy is not only a necessity for mitigating climate change but also an opportunity to boost their national economies. It is essential for policymakers to consider all aspects of this issue and make informed decisions in the best interest of their citizens and the planet.
